About the area
Longview
Located in Longview, this cottage is in a rural area and on the waterfront. Triangle Bowl and Regal Three Rivers Mall are worth checking out if an activity is on the agenda, while those wishing to experience the area's natural beauty can explore Lake Sacajawea Park and Tam O'Shanter Park. Kayaking and scuba diving offer great chances to get out on the surrounding water, or you can seek out an adventure with hunting and mountain biking nearby.

About the host
Hosted by Jessica
I am a mom of two from born and raised in Montana. I am a teacher who is taking time to be home with my two littles and trying to rent our tiny house so I can afford to stay home. My husband and I moved to the PNW for his work, and we love it here.
Why they chose this property
We love this space because it is surrounded by nature and is peaceful. It is a great place to slow down and enjoy nature.
What makes this property unique
Our tiny house is a one-of-a-kind build by a local artist who based his design on his home in Scandinavia. Its large window overlooking a private forest makes it an ideal space for anyone who loves tiny homes, big views, or nature.
